Transaction a80596dbd0509b54920849e31c97c4d9f070bb505d53c96f112e18e9e0139b47

1 Input
2 Outputs
  • a80596dbd0509b54920849e31c97c4d9f070bb505d53c96f112e18e9e0139b47:0
  • value  681325713
    address  3DDPgbRdAqVgZrvDiAdQ3xvqmcB55SHWTo
  • a80596dbd0509b54920849e31c97c4d9f070bb505d53c96f112e18e9e0139b47:1
  • value  6955000
    address  15ZwfTeqGW1QGdR83ngbTNyyXp9uFngbnw